Fairacres pairs architectural pedigree with everyday convenience, offering wide streets, mature trees, and gracious early-20th-century homes that reflect the neighborhood’s storied roots. Positioned along the Dodge corridor, it places residents minutes from cultural staples and green space. Memorial Park’s rolling lawns and annual commemorations are a quick hop away, as is the woodland serenity of Elmwood Park for trails, picnics, and playgrounds. Proximity to Omaha’s urban core keeps dining, arts, and employers within easy reach, while the intimate storefronts of nearby Dundee make coffee runs and date nights pleasantly walkable.
Families prize the area’s educational mix. Dundee Elementary (Omaha Public Schools) anchors neighborhood learning, with esteemed private options close by, including the independent Brownell Talbot and all-boys Creighton Preparatory School. The University of Nebraska at Omaha brings lectures, performances, and Division I athletics to the doorstep, enriching community life and offering convenient continuing education through UNO. With a location in Douglas County and quick access to major arterials, commutes across the city are straightforward.
